Oven-baked vegetables with cheese sauce

Ingredients for 4 servings:

  • 2 kohlrabi
  • 8 carrots
  • 350 g potatoes
  • 400 g mushrooms
  • 1 bunch of parsley
  • salt and pepper
  • 8 tbsp cheese, grated
  • 375 ml milk
  • 6 tbsp cream cheese with herbs

Instructions

Working time approx. 20 minutes; Total time approx. 20 minutes

Cut the kohlrabi and carrots into strips, dice the potatoes, and quarter the mushrooms. Finely chop the parsley. Cook the kohlrabi, carrots, and potatoes for about 5 minutes to reduce their hardness. If you prefer firm vegetables, you can skip the pre-cooking. Layer all the vegetables in a baking dish, season with salt and pepper, and sprinkle with parsley. Mix the cheese, milk, and cream cheese, season with salt and pepper to taste, pour over the roasted vegetables, and bake in a preheated oven at 180°C for 40-45 minutes.
